The General Multiplication Rule (Explanation & Examples) The general multiplication rule states that the probability of any two events, A and B, both happening can be calculated as: P (A and B) = P (A) * P (B|A) The vertical bar | means "given." So Maya did not get silk, then that means that silk is still in the mix, but there's only five possibilities left because Maya picked one of them, and four of them are not silk. 0000001118 00000 n We can use the general multiplication rule to find the probability that two events both occur when the events are not independent.
